Kim Urban, of Mantua, our beautiful Mother, the best Grammie, loving partner and loyal friend, passed away Tuesday, June 21, 2022, after a courageous battle with pancreatic cancer. Kim was born on April 30, 1954, in Cleveland, Ohio, the daughter of the late Gerald and Dorothy (Truman) Walker. A long time area resident, Kim was a 1972 graduate of Crestwood High School. She had been employed as a manager at Estee Lauder in Aurora for 16 years. A vivacious lady, she will be remembered for her traveling with her dear friends Gary and Karen Hogan, her cooking and baking skills, shopping with Megan, and as an avid Indians and Cavs supporter. The memories she created with family, including her grandchildren whom she loved and adored, will remain forever. Kim is survived by her children, Gary (Lisa) Urban, Melanie (Eric) Schoch, Megan (Randy) Miller, all of Mantua, and Rachel (Tim King) Urban of North Royalton; grandchildren Tucker, Emma, Dillon, Ryder, Abbey, Reagan, Grahm, Parker, and Callie. Kim is also survived by her sweetheart Ed Douglas. Her sister Janet Christensen preceded her in death. No calling hours. Final resting place is at Westlawn Cemetery, Mantua Twp., Ohio. A Celebration of Life will be held Wednesday, July 6, 2022, 5:00 P.M. at Parkside Church in Chagrin Falls.
